Given Minnesota's harsh winters, common issues include aging battery and electrical system failures, AWD system maintenance for gravel and snowy roads, and corrosion on brake lines and undercarriage from road salt. Volvo's turbocharged engines also require strict adherence to oil change intervals to prevent sludge buildup.
For routine maintenance (oil changes, brakes, tires) and minor repairs, a trusted local shop in Fairmont with European car experience is sufficient. For complex electrical diagnostics, software updates, or warranty work, a trip to an authorized Volvo dealership is often necessary for access to the latest technical service bulletins and proprietary software.
Beyond standard winter tires, have a local shop conduct a pre-winter inspection focusing on the battery, block heater, thermostat, and coolant mixture specific to your Volvo model. Ensure the all-wheel-drive system is functioning correctly for traction on icy rural roads and gravel drives common in the area.
